RTCA is a standards organization that develops consensus-based standards for aviation. They create Minimum Operational Performance Standards (MOPS) and Minimum Aviation System Performance Standards (MASPS) that are used by the FAA and the aviation industry for certifying equipment and systems used in aircraft and air traffic management. These standards help ensure safety and interoperability in the aviation ecosystem.
